Cost
Many suffer from mental health problems and may not seek treatment due to the expense. Psychiatrists provide a variety of mental health services that are typically more affordable than other forms of treatment. These services may include therapy, medication administration and other treatments.
The cost to see a psychiatrist varies depending on the type of treatment you want. However, the majority of health insurance plans cover visits with a psychiatrist. To find out about costs, you should talk about your needs with the psychiatrist with whom you're considering working.
Mira the application that provides virtual healthcare services that can help you save money on a visit to a psychiatrist. These apps let you to video chat with a psychiatrist, thus reducing the cost. Apps can also give you access to other medical professionals, such as nurses and doctors. You can also save money on lab tests and medications prescribed by your psychiatrist.
Some health insurance policies include a deductible which must be met to cover certain medical expenses, for instance, visits to a psychiatrist. The deductible can vary by plan, so check your policy to determine you'll be paying for each visit. Furthermore, some insurance companies will only cover a specific amount of psychiatric visits per month or year. If you fail to meet the required number of sessions, the full fee will be charged for each visit.

The CoP states that if a person has not requested or consented to seclusion, then it should only be used when they likely to cause harm to others and this risk cannot be effectively managed with other methods. However it is unlikely healthcare providers will be able to impose an legally valid restriction on a person's right to freedom by locking them in their rooms. They will require police or PHO presence on the ward in order to enforce this. This isn't practical and it would be difficult for a judge to justify in light of the current constraints on resources.
It is also unclear if a person who lacks capacity to make their own decisions can consent to be isolated on a psychiatric ward. Owen's team must be careful to determine if he has the capacity to agree to isolation in the light of his behavior disorder, or indeed any risk to him or anyone else. Ines's situation is less than clear, however she is unlikely to be capable of accepting the same treatment as Owen, if she's suffering from an untreated hypomanic attack.
It may therefore be more practicable to use public health legislation rather than the MHA 1983, except if physical violence is or physical violence. In any case it is likely that the UK Government would have to provide more practical guidance on how to view isolation in mental health wards in the event that the COVID-19 pandemic strikes.

Due to the scarcity of psychiatrists, new and existing patients aren't always able to consult a psychiatrist. The number of people who require treatment is growing more quickly than the number of psychiatrists available. Some people had to wait for months to book an appointment with a psychiatrist. This is even worse for those in the most disadvantaged groups, who have less access to psychiatrists.
To combat the shortage of psychiatrists, many health care providers are implementing new solutions to ensure that patients receive the help they need. Some of these include partnering up with primary care doctors and using the power of telehealth to treat patients. Additionally, some insurance companies are beginning to offer telehealth services to their members.

After graduating from medical school, psychiatrists who are aspiring must complete four years of residency. During their residency they will gain the necessary experience to treat a variety of mental health issues. Some psychiatric residents choose to specialize in a particular area of medicine, for instance consultation-liaison psychiatry (working with patients who have medical and psychiatric issues) as well as forensic psychiatry, or reproductive psychotherapy (pregnant women who have psychiatric issues).
